Lighting

The lighting deserves a special mention. In low rooms, you should not weigh voluminous chandeliers - they “eat up” a lot of space. It is better to choose more "flat" models that do not take up much space. When choosing such a chandelier, you need to pay attention to the presence of a special protective screen.

Such a screen is a mirror plate that reflects heat from the surface of the stretched film. If it is heated too much, the film may simply melt and therefore, the presence of such a detail in the design of the chandelier is a prerequisite. Even better if the lamp will be installed LED lamp, which slightly heat up during operation.

In some cases, pendant lights can be completely abandoned. They can be successfully replaced by built-in illuminators. However, here you may encounter a small problem - the canvas is stretched as close to the ceiling as possible to save space, and there is simply not enough space to install some models of built-in lighting fixtures.

The solution will be all the same LEDs. Lighting devices that use such lamps are very thin and in most cases can be mounted without any problems in any ceiling composition. In addition, such lighting will help save on electricity bills - the energy consumption of diodes is much less than that of classic lamps.

How to finish a wooden ceiling?

To make a choice finishing materials for the ceiling of a private house made of wood, you need to take into account the features of the device ceilings:

  • floors wooden house lightweight, and made with the help of beams;
  • between the beams there is a space that is filled with insulating material. The warmed space is closed by finishing;
  • a wooden house shrinks, which affects the ceiling covering.

Finishing a wooden ceiling in a private house is best done with wood materials. Natural material is combined with any style of a country house, will maintain an optimal level of temperature and humidity.

Important: when choosing a tree for finishing ceilings, it is necessary to periodically treat the coating with special agents that protect against moisture.

If you mount a wooden ceiling for the bathroom and kitchen, then there is a possibility of mold. In rooms with high humidity, it is better to refuse to decorate the ceilings with wood. For the bathrooms of a wooden house, a stretch coating is suitable.

wood flooring

Lining made of wood is considered the most common type of cladding, due to the following properties:

  1. good soundproofing and heat-insulating properties;
  2. the ability to close defects in the ceiling;
  3. no surface preparation required;
  4. long service life, if you properly care for the ceiling. It is necessary to periodically impregnate the material with a special composition;
  5. fast installation;
  6. suitable for any design solutions interior.

The disadvantages of lining include the possibility of deformation during sudden temperature changes and flammability.

Usually, lining made of pine, linden and oak, larch is used for ceilings.

The optimal ceiling height in the apartment is 2.4-2.5 meters. If the height is less, the ceilings can "press" on those present. And the lower the ceilings, the stronger this effect. Unfortunately, in typical Khrushchev, the ceilings, as a rule, are not high enough. There is only one way to really raise the ceiling - to remove the plank floors on the logs and make a screed. Ceilings will be several centimeters higher, and this, of course, will be noticeable.

All other ways to raise the ceiling are based only on visual illusions. In the arsenal of designers there are several tricks to eliminate the effect of "pressure" of the ceiling and visually enlarge it, thereby making the room visually more spacious and pleasant. What are these tricks?

Low ceiling: how to visually raise it?

1. The right choice of color for the ceiling. Light cold shades tend to visually move away from us. It seems that surfaces painted in such colors seem to move away, so the room visually increases. You can choose a cool white-gray color or a light pearl shade for the ceiling. Blue and green objects also visually move away. Therefore, a low ceiling can be painted in light blue, gray-blue or cold pale green.

The effect of infinity can be achieved by turning the ceiling into the sky - that is, pasting it with wallpaper with a heavenly pattern or decorating it with an appropriate painting. You can order and installation of stretch ceilings with sky photo print.

An effective technique suitable for a child: decoration with a heavenly pattern on the wall and ceiling. At the same time, the boundary between the wall and the ceiling is blurred, and the top of the room begins to seem endless.

2. Reflective ceiling. A mirrored ceiling is the dream of many. But a real mirrored ceiling is not very safe. Ideally this should be suspended ceiling With metal frame and fixed on it with small mirror panels. Nowadays, instead of a real mirror, mirrored polystyrene panels are more often used. Installation of such a design will lower the ceiling by several centimeters, although this drawback is leveled by the illusion of having a second floor with a transparent floor. If possible, you can choose such a solution - for example, for a living room, bathroom, hall,.

A safe "mirror solution" is glossy stretch ceilings. Such a ceiling makes the room taller, but the reflection is still blurry.

As for the color, you need to choose a canvas of one of those shades that were mentioned above: cold grayish, pearly, bluish, subtle green, etc.

3. Vertical drawing of the walls. Wallpaper in a narrow vertical stripe is a classic of the genre when it comes to a low room. It is desirable that the strip is not too contrasting.

You should not distinguish between a plain ceiling and striped walls with a wide ceiling plinth. Let it be better to be narrow and merging with the color of the ceiling. Otherwise, being too noticeable, it will “cut off” the ceiling from the walls and thereby emphasize their small height.

An interesting technique is pasting the walls with striped wallpaper with a slight entry to the ceiling: the walls will appear higher.

Wallpaper does not have to be striped - it can be any vertical pattern, floral or geometric. In addition, the wallpaper can be plain, but textured with a vertical orientation of the texture.

4. Ceiling with the illusion of volume. Above may seem like a coffered ceiling. You can use not very large ones by gluing them transversely to the ceiling. The moldings should be lighter than the space inside the resulting squares (or diamonds). This space needs to be painted in a darker and preferably cold color - the ceiling seems to deepen.

5. Playing with lighting. Bulky low chandeliers are absolutely not suitable. You can mount a flat chandelier ceiling lamp on the ceiling. If it is a suspended or stretch ceiling, you should give preference to spotlights.

So that the ceiling does not press, the following technique is used: under the ceiling, several lamps are mounted around the perimeter of the room with lamps up or up and down. Their light illuminates the ceiling only along the perimeter, and the center of the ceiling remains dark: it is not clear whether it is high or low. In any case, the effect of "pressure" disappears.

By the same principle, you can organize a desktop and floor, the light from which will create bright spots on the ceiling, but not completely illuminate it.

6. Furniture. Furniture can also help adjust the height of the room. Tall narrow showcases, racks, racks will visually stretch the walls (the same principle as the vertical pattern on the walls).

Furniture should not be too bulky - it is better to give preference to neat, minimalist items.

Against the background of tall narrow cabinets, showcases and shelving, low coffee tables (in Japanese and) and TV stands will seem quite miniature. It will give the impression that they only seem so low due to the height of the room. This is a game of contrasts.

7. Decor and curtains. Choose long curtains and hang the curtain directly from the ceiling. Let them reach the floor.

Visually increase the low ceilings will help the vertical fold on the curtains. For kitchen and other rooms, you can give preference to vertical blinds.

No. 2. What should be the finish?

The main nuance in the design of low ceilings is the choice of suitable finishing materials. The correct color and texture of the finish is half the battle.

To make the ceiling in a low room visually higher, use these design tricks:

  • bet on white. This is a win-win option for all small and low spaces. White color and light, pastel shades allow you to work wonders and literally push the boundaries of space. Paint the ceiling White color- this is the simplest and at the same time very effective solution;
  • gloss and shine. We all know how well glossy surfaces reflect light. If the gloss is strong, then it is able to work like a mirror and literally duplicate the space, so you can’t imagine a better solution for a low room than glossy ceilings. You can paint the surface with glossy paint, you can install white. The latter option is more often than usual used by designers and, indeed, works very, very well to increase the height of the room;
  • blue shades for the ceiling. Many people call a white ceiling a hospital or office ceiling. If, in fact, it will cause discomfort, then you can resort to an alternative solution - shades of blue. This color in our subconscious is associated with the sky, so the surface of the ceiling will automatically appear slightly higher than it actually is;
  • the ceiling should be lighter than the walls. Whatever experiments with colors you decide on, you must remember that the walls should not be lighter than the ceiling. Otherwise, the ceiling will press even more and seem lower than it is;
  • ceiling and walls in one color. This is a popular design move that allows you to blur the border of the transition of the wall surface to the ceiling;
  • box and moldings. If you lay out a box or make moldings from or special ones along the edges of the ceiling, you can visually deepen the center of the ceiling. It is important that the thickness of such decorative structures is small, otherwise you can get the opposite effect. It is better to decide on such experiments if the ceiling height is 2.5-2.7 m;
  • vertical stripe- Another win-win way to raise the ceiling. It is better that the stripes are wide and combine not too contrasting colors. Only one accent wall is made striped, otherwise it will ripple in the eyes. Instead of the usual stripes, you can use an ornament of tree trunks or rhombuses. Vertical stripes can be drawn on a painted wall, or wallpaper with a suitable pattern can be used. Strips can go to the ceiling. They also work well;


  • ombre effect. This is a bold and fashionable solution. Using the transition from a saturated color at the bottom of the wall to a light and white at the top, you can achieve the effect of merging the ceiling and walls. The result is a visually higher ceiling.
